The Simple Answer: Can I Use EBT at Nothing Bundt Cakes?

The short answer is no, Nothing Bundt Cakes does not accept EBT cards. This means you won’t be able to use your food assistance benefits to purchase their cakes, unfortunately.

What Items Can I Usually Buy with EBT?

EBT cards are generally designed to purchase food items. But what exactly falls under that category? The rules can vary a bit by state, but generally, you can use your EBT card for:

  • Fruits and vegetables
  • Meat, poultry, and fish
  • Dairy products (milk, cheese, yogurt)
  • Breads and cereals
  • Seeds and plants to grow food

Things like alcohol, tobacco, pet food, and non-food items are typically not covered. So even though a Nothing Bundt Cake is a food item, the specific store policies come into play.

It’s a good idea to check the specific rules in your state or with the EBT card provider.

This will help you understand the details of what your card can and cannot buy.

Why Doesn’t Nothing Bundt Cakes Accept EBT?

There are several reasons why a business might not accept EBT. It often comes down to the type of business and the nature of the products they sell.

One key factor is that the rules for EBT acceptance are quite detailed. Businesses must meet specific requirements to participate. This can involve things like special point-of-sale (POS) systems, which can be a hassle for certain stores. Another reason is the business model.

Small businesses and specialty stores might not be set up to handle EBT transactions. They may not have the resources or the need to implement the necessary systems. They may not want to deal with all the government paperwork.

They may also find that EBT doesn’t align with their target market or the type of goods they typically sell.
